    Understanding Furnace Heat Exchangers

    Understanding furnace heat exchangers is crucial for ensuring your heating system operates efficiently and safely. A well-maintained heat exchanger improves indoor air quality and enhances the overall comfort of your home.

    What Is a Heat Exchanger?

    A heat exchanger transfers heat between two or more fluids without mixing them. In a furnace, the heat exchanger allows heat from the combustion process to warm the air circulating through your home. Common materials include steel or aluminum, which withstand high temperatures. Signs of wear, such as cracks or rust, indicate potential issues that require immediate attention.

    Importance of Regular Inspection

    Regular inspection of the heat exchanger prevents costly repairs and enhances safety. Cracks or leaks can release harmful gases into your living space. Inspecting once a year before the heating season ensures your furnace operates efficiently. Use a qualified technician for thorough checks. Regular maintenance reduces the risk of unexpected breakdowns, ensuring your home stays warm and safe.

    Step-by-Step Guide to Inspecting a Furnace Heat Exchanger

    Inspecting your furnace heat exchanger ensures safe and efficient operation. Follow these steps for a thorough check.

    Preparing for the Inspection

    1. Gather Tools and Safety Gear: Before you start, collect necessary tools and safety equipment. Use a flashlight, screwdriver set, inspection mirror, thermometer, wire brush, multimeter, and a service manual. Equip yourself with goggles, gloves, a dust mask, protective clothing, and knee pads.
    2. Turn Off Power and Gas Supply: Safety first. Turn off the furnace at the thermostat. Disconnect the power to the unit at the breaker box. If your furnace uses gas, shut off the gas supply.
    3. Allow Time to Cool: Let the furnace cool completely. This prevents burns or injuries during the inspection.

    Visual Inspection Techniques

    1. Inspect the Exterior: Begin with the outside of the heat exchanger. Look for visible signs of damage like cracks or rust. Examine the areas where the heat exchanger connects to the furnace.
    2. Examine Inside Access Panels: Open access panels carefully. Check for debris, corrosion, or signs of overheating. Clear away any dust or dirt using a wire brush.
    3. Use an Inspection Mirror: Utilize the inspection mirror to view hard-to-reach areas. Move it around to get a complete view of the surfaces inside the heat exchanger.
    1. Perform a Visual Check for Soot or Discoloration: Look for soot buildup, dark stains, or discoloration. These signs often indicate gas leaks.
    2. Conduct a Smoke Test: Use a smoke pencil to identify leaks. Move the smoke pencil around the seams of the heat exchanger. Watch for the smoke being pulled into any cracks or holes.
    3. Pressure Test: Consider using a manometer to check pressure within the heat exchanger. If the pressure reading is low, a leak may exist.

    Following these steps ensures a thorough inspection of your furnace heat exchanger. Early detection prevents issues and maintains a safe home environment.

    Common Issues to Look For

    Inspecting your furnace heat exchanger involves checking for various issues that could affect performance and safety. Watch for these common problems during your inspection to ensure your furnace operates correctly.

    Signs of Wear and Tear

    Look for signs of wear and tear on your heat exchanger. Common indicators include:

    • Rust or Corrosion: Discoloration or flaking surfaces can signal moisture problems and compromise the heat exchanger’s integrity.
    • Soot Buildup: Black, sooty deposits may indicate incomplete combustion, suggesting that your heat exchanger isn’t operating efficiently.
    • Discoloration Patterns: Uneven colors on the heat exchanger could indicate overheating or poor airflow, pointing toward underlying issues that need attention.

    Identifying Cracks and Damage

    Identifying cracks and damage is crucial for maintaining safety. Focus on these aspects:

    • Visual Inspections: Carefully examine the heat exchanger for any visible cracks, holes, or separations in the metal. Small cracks can lead to significant gas leaks over time.
    • Smoke Test: Perform a smoke test by introducing smoke at various points. If smoke escapes from unwanted areas, it indicates leaks or cracks in the heat exchanger.
    • Sound Check: Listen for unusual noises like hissing or whistling during the furnace operation. These sounds may suggest air or gas escaping through cracks.
    • Thermal Imaging: Use a thermal imaging camera to spot temperature irregularities. Areas that show unexpected temperature drops may hint at cracks or compromised surfaces.
